
In an interview published by the Washington Post on Friday, President Volodymyr Zelenskyi said that if Ukraine does not receive the promised US military aid, blocked by disputes in Congress, its forces will be forced to withdraw “in small steps”, according to Reuters.
“If there is no support from the US, that means we have no air defense, we have no Patriot missiles, we have no electronic warfare, we have no 155mm artillery shells,” Zelensky told the Washington Post.
“That means we’re going to go back, we’re going to go away, step by step, small steps,” he said. “We’re trying to find a way not to retire.”
The lack of ammunition, he said, means that “you have to settle for less. as? Of course, come back. Make the front line shorter. If it breaks, the Russians could reach big cities.”
Democratic President Joe Biden urged the Republican-controlled U.S. House of Representatives to approve the military and financial aid package, but House Speaker Mike Johnson held off for months, citing domestic priorities.
In a phone call Thursday, Zelensky told Johnson that approval of the package was vital.
Last month, Russian troops captured the eastern town of Avdiyivka and have made small gains since then, but the front line has changed little in recent months.
In an interview, the Ukrainian president noted that Ukraine compensates for the lack of missiles with weapons and air defense systems produced in the country, “but this is not enough.”
After more than two years of war, Russia has stepped up attacks on energy and other infrastructure in recent weeks.
Ukrainian forces have been unable to advance, and Zelenskyi has said that Kyiv plans to continue attacking targets in Russia, including oil refineries.
According to him, Washington’s reaction to the wave of Ukrainian attacks was not “positive”, but Kyiv uses its own drones.
“We used our drones. Nobody can tell us you can’t,” he told the paper. “If there’s no air defense to protect our energy system and the Russians attack it, my question is why can’t we hit them back? “, – he said.
“Their society must learn to live without gasoline, without diesel, without electricity. When Russia stops these measures, we will stop too,” concluded the President of Ukraine.
